广州阿里云代理商:ASP连接SQL数据库代码
随着云计算的飞速发展,越来越多的企业开始选择使用云服务来托管和管理他们的应用程序与数据库。作为国内领先的云服务提供商,阿里云凭借其强大的基础设施和完善的服务体系,已经成为无数企业在云计算领域的首选。本文将以广州阿里云代理商为背景,探讨如何使用ASP连接SQL数据库,并展示阿里云的优势。
阿里云的优势
阿里云作为国内云计算行业的佼佼者,具有以下几个显著的优势:
- 强大的基础设施支持:阿里云拥有全球领先的数据中心和庞大的计算资源。其云服务器 ECS(Elastic Compute Service)和 RDS(关系型数据库服务)具备高可用性、高性能和可扩展性,能够满足各类企业对计算、存储、网络等方面的需求。
- 高可靠性与稳定性:阿里云提供99.99%的服务可用性保障,通过多重备份机制和容灾方案,确保用户的数据安全和应用的高可用性。
- 全球化布局:阿里云在全球多个地区建立了数据中心,并通过全球加速服务为企业提供快速、稳定的网络连接,支持跨国业务的拓展。
- 安全保障:阿里云通过多种安全防护措施,如DDoS防护、WAF(Web应用防火墙)、数据加密等,提供全面的安全保障,保护用户的应用程序和数据不受外部威胁。
- 灵活的计费模式:阿里云提供按需计费、包年包月等多种灵活的收费模式,帮助企业根据实际需求选择合适的服务方案,降低了使用成本。
如何使用ASP连接SQL数据库
阿里云的RDS(关系型数据库服务)支持MySQL、SQL Server等主流数据库,开发者可以通过ASP(Active Server Pages)连接SQL数据库,并进行数据操作。以下是一个使用ASP连接SQL Server数据库的示例代码:
<%
' 设置数据库连接字符串
Dim connString
connString = "Provider=SQLOLEDB;Data Source=your-database-endpoint;Initial Catalog=your-database-name;User ID=your-username;Password=your-password;"
' 创建连接对象
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
' 打开数据库连接
conn.Open connString
' 定义SQL查询语句
Dim sql
sql = "SELECT * FROM your_table_name"
' 执行查询
Dim rs
Set rs = conn.Execute(sql)
' 输出查询结果
Do While Not rs.EOF
Response.Write(rs("column_name") & "
")
rs.MoveNext
Loop
' 关闭记录集和连接
r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>
上述代码通过ADO(ActiveX Data Objects)连接到SQL Server数据库,并执行简单的查询操作。在实际应用中,您需要根据您的数据库连接信息(如数据库的端点、用户名和密码)修改代码。
如何在阿里云上配置SQL数据库
在阿里云上,使用SQL数据库的流程大致分为以下几个步骤:
- 注册并登录阿里云账号:首先,您需要注册一个阿里云账号并登录到阿里云控制台。
- 创建RDS实例:在阿里云控制台中,选择“云数据库RDS”,根据需要选择合适的数据库类型(如SQL Server)和配置(如存储、带宽等),创建一个新的RDS实例。
- 配置数据库连接信息:在创建RDS实例之后,您可以在控制台查看数据库的连接信息,包括数据库的内网和外网地址、用户名、密码等。这些信息将在ASP代码中用来建立数据库连接。
- 设置安全组和防火墙规则:为了确保您的数据库能够被正确访问,您需要在阿里云控制台配置安全组和防火墙规则,允许指定的IP地址访问数据库。
- 连接与使用数据库:完成配置后,您可以使用ASP代码连接并操作数据库,进行数据查询、插入、更新等操作。
阿里云的技术支持与服务
阿里云提供24小时全天候技术支持,您可以通过在线客服、电话支持或提交工单的方式,获得及时的技术帮助。对于企业用户,阿里云还提供专属客户经理和定制化的解决方案,确保企业能够最大程度地发挥云计算的优势。
总结
阿里云作为国内领先的云计算服务商,凭借其强大的基础设施、安全保障、全球化布局以及灵活的计费方式,成为了众多企业选择云服务的首选平台。在使用阿里云提供的云数据库时,开发者可以通过ASP语言方便地连接SQL数据库,进行数据操作。通过本文的介绍,您可以清晰地了解如何在阿里云上配置数据库并使用ASP进行连接,同时也能更好地认识到阿里云在云计算领域的优势和技术支持。相信通过阿里云,您能够实现更高效、安全、稳定的应用开发与部署。